The Ranch Saloon

Description: Business correspondence written on letterhead from the late 19th century. Letterhead includes decorative designs and business name, with text reading: "Established 1889. Johnson & Heard, Proprietors of the Ranch Saloon, Opposite Texas & Pacific and Pecos Valley Railroad Depot"; "Sole Agents for Delmonica Sour Mash and Puritan Rye Whiskey. The Best Quality of Fine Liquors, Wines and Cigars"; "Fine Assortment of Case Goods and Anheuser Busch Beer On Hand At All Times."
Date: 1895
Partner: Texas General Land Office

[T&P Station in Pecos City, Texas]

Description: Copy photo of the T&P depot in Pecos City, Texas. The top right corner of the photo is torn, and there are six men lined up in front of the building. Written on the photo is "The old TP Depot of Pecos city 1892." Written below the image are "Pecos City Texas - T&P Station 1892" and "West of the Pecos Museum / Barney Hubbs."
Date: 1892
Creator: Hubbs, Barney
Partner: The Grace Museum
